The Annatorte is outstanding. Its nougat glaze, shaped like waves, mimics Anna's hairstyle bun. The cake has a unique flavor resulting from the combination of chocolate, orange liqueur, and nougat. It's not overly sweet but strikes a pleasant balance between the different flavors.

Capital of AustriaVienna is the capital, largest city, and one of nine federal states of Austria. Vienna is Austria's most populous city and its primate city, with about two million inhabitants, and its cultural, economic, and political center. source
